In 1850, the American Gold Rush swept across the West, and countless people flooded into California with the dream of getting rich overnight. After traveling overland, he became a Chinese "pig boy" whose family was in trouble and went to the United States to pan for gold. He started out as an oppressed miner, dug gold mines, tamed horses, built pastures, protected compatriots, fought against white people, resisted anti-Chinese thugs, and built a private town... A legendary journey to control the West began.
